Snow Ice Cream Recipe #1
To make snow ice cream, simply add 1 cup of half and half or milk, 1 cup of white sugar and 1 tablespoon of vanilla extract to your gallon of fresh snow. In a pinch, you can substitute 28 ounces (2 cans) of sweetened condensed milk in place of the milk and sugar when making snow ice cream. More information here.
Snow Ice Cream Recipe #2
You'll need 8 cups of clean snow, plus 1 cup of milk, half cup of sugar and half teaspoon of vanilla extract. Firstly, mix the milk, sugar and vanilla extract. Mix them thoroughly so that the sugar is dissolved in the milk. Now take half a cup of snow and start mixing it in this mixture. Add the snow little by little into the mixture and mix it thoroughly. Keep mixing the snow in the mixture until the ice cream is formed.
